Key senators laud Obama ‘clean energy’ push (RINOs Graham, Lugar join Dems in supporting Obama plan)
Politico ^ | 2011-01-26 | Darren Goode

Posted on 01/27/2011 7:47:47 AM PST by rabscuttle385

President Obama’s call for Congress to pass a mandate that includes both traditional renewable energy sources like wind and solar as well as GOP favorites nuclear and “clean coal” may be the driver needed to bang through the most aggressive and politically feasible means of reducing greenhouse gas emissions on Capitol Hill this Congress.

Obama set a new goal in his speech Tuesday night, calling for 80 percent of U.S. electricity to stem from “clean energy” sources by 2035. “Some folks want wind and solar. Others want nuclear, clean coal, and natural gas,” Obama said. “To meet this goal, we will need them all – and I urge Democrats and Republicans to work together to make it happen.”

The idea of a “clean energy standard” has been batted around in recent years and has received bipartisan interest.

“Outstanding. It’s terrific,” said Sen. John Kerry (D-Mass.).

Sens. Lindsey Graham (R-S.C.) and Richard Lugar (R-Ind.) have proposed the idea and Democrats like Mark Begich (D-Alaska), Tom Carper (D-Del.) and Amy Klobuchar (D-Minn.) have shown interest.
